Paris Jackson Slams Michael Jackson Fans Over These Critiques Ahead Of Anniversary Of Her Father's Death
Paris posted a video message to her Instagram story and told people that she didn't have any control of the schedule.
'One of the tour dates I'm supposed to be going out on tour with Incubus and Manchester Orchestra happens to be June 25, which is a very negative anniversary for me in my life and my family,' Paris said, according to Deadline. 'When you're first of three, and you're not headlining these shows, you don't pick what date you perform or what time you go on stage to perform, or what city you perform in.'
Paris also said she doesn't get any special treatment as the additional opening act.
'First of three also doesn't get a tour bus,' she said. 'You get maybe a sprinter van, which I've done before when I've got a band with me. But I'm not going to have my band with me this time.'
Paris said she will only have her acoustic guitar and fiancé Justin Long, who happens to be her sound guy.
'So we're gonna be in a soccer mum van,' she said. 'This feels like [Incubus is] doing me a favour by bringing me out on tour. So [what], I'm gonna tell 'em, 'Sorry, guys, we can't perform on this date?''
Paris closed her message with a 'F**k you.'
At 50, Michael Jackson died on June 25, 2009, from cardiac arrest, leaving behind three children, Prince, Paris and Bigi (formerly known as Blanket).
In 2021, Paris joined supermodel Naomi Campbell for her No Filter with Naomi series via YouTube.
'My dad was really good about making sure we were cultured, making sure we were educated, and not just showing us like the glitz and glam, like hotel hopping, five-star places,' Paris said about being raised by the King of Pop.

Hailey Bieber encouraged Justin Bieber to follow his artistic instincts on Swag
Justin and Hailey Bieber are celebrating his new album Swag together. The 31-year-old singer has surprised fans by releasing his first solo record in more than four years and Hailey, 28, is said to have been instrumental in encouraging Justin to 'follow his artistic instincts'. A source told PEOPLE: "Hailey was by Justin's side for the whole creation of the album. Everyone knows Justin as a star and a performer. They now get to know the artist that Hailey has known all these years. 'Hailey supported Justin to follow his artistic instincts. She helped him to trust himself and do what Justin knew he wanted to do as an artist." Hailey is also believed to be responsible for encouraging Justin to "run his own show" by choosing the musicians and producers he collaborated with and creating a more "stripped-down" style. This is Justin's first album since he parted ways with longtime manager Scooter Braun, 44, and he is said to be relishing the chance to finally have creative control. An insider told Rolling Stone: 'Breaking away from Scooter Braun and his team has been something that Justin has wanted for so long, and now that he's fully free, he could finally share this album with his fans and with the world. Having full creative freedom, sadly, is something new for him as an artist. Not having to stress about creating the perfect single, or perfect album, allowed for him to create the best body of music he's ever made.' Justin and Braun, 44, worked together for more than 15 years before ending their business relationship in 2023.

Ariel Winter Reveals She Received 'Inappropriate Messages From Older Men' As A Child Working In Hollywood
Ariel Winter recently opened up about the traumatic experience of being preyed upon by older men as a child actress in Hollywood. The Modern Family alumna discussed her experience while promoting the YouTube true crime docuseries SOSA Undercover in which she appears; the online show follows members of the Safe from Online Sex Abuse nonprofit organization as they work with law enforcement to uncover and apprehend perpetrators of sexual abuse and sex trafficking. She continued, 'I don't wanna say too much about it, but by the time I was on a laptop and cell phone, I was getting inappropriate messages from older men, and it caused trauma.' As a result, Winter said she sought professional help: 'The experiences I had in person and online as a child have affected me so deeply that I've had to go to therapy for it. The movie and TV industry is a dark place.' Winter first rose to fame portraying brainiac middle child Alex Dunphy in the popular ABC mockumentary-style sitcom about a chaotic yet loving extended family, a part she landed at just 11 years old. Her experience unfortunately echoes what many young starlets have detailed about their time growing up in the public eye of the entertainment industry, including Jenna Ortega, who shared last year that she left social media after being sent explicit content as a young girl. Previously, Winter also discussed the relentless body-shaming she faced while going through her teen years on camera: 'That was a major part of my teenage years,' she told People in part. 'It was just everywhere. It was every headline I read about myself, like, grown people writing articles about me saying how I looked terrible or pregnant or like a fat slut. I mean, I was 14.
